Immigrants from Greece vs Maltese Ambulatory Disability Correlation Chart
The statistical analysis conducted on geographies consisting of 216,870,944 people shows a strong positive correlation between the proportion of Immigrants from Greece and percentage of population with ambulatory disability in the United States with a correlation coefficient (R) of 0.732 and weighted average of 6.0%. Similarly, the statistical analysis conducted on geographies consisting of 126,465,300 people shows a weak positive correlation between the proportion of Maltese and percentage of population with ambulatory disability in the United States with a correlation coefficient (R) of 0.260 and weighted average of 6.0%, a difference of 0.080%.
